What is licorice root?

Derived from the glycyrrhiza glabra plant, licorice has long been prized in Japan due to its medicinal properties and health benefits. Scientists more recently discovered that licorice root extract is an emulsifier, which allows both water and oil-based ingredients to mix effectively. This can be a challenge, since water and oil tend to separate, and natural emulsifiers are even harder to come across in skincare. But licorice root extract improves the consistency of products and more importantly, allows our skincare products to deliver benefits to our skin!

It works like magic on sun damage

Licorice root in skincare is a vital sun protection ingredient. In addition to helping brighten skin already affected by sun damage, licorice helps stop discolouration in its tracks during and immediately after sun exposure.

It reduces pigmentation and hyperpigmentation like a boss

Licorice root extract is known to inhibit the secretion of tyrosinase, which helps to prevent dark spots from forming on the skin. But licorice root extract not only stops new dark spots in their tracks, but it is said to help fade existing ones.
